Surrey County Council
Lower Guildford Road (D3605) (Service Road) Knaphill
Temporary Prohibition of Traffic Order 2024

On 14 February 2024 Surrey County Council made the above mentioned Temporary Traffic Order under Section 14(1) of the Road Traffic Regulation Act 1984, the effect of which will be to prohibit vehicles from entering or proceeding in that length of Lower Guildford Road (D3605) (Service Road) Knaphill as extends from its junction with (D3608) Northwood Avenue to a point in line with the common boundary between No.82 and No.84 Lower Guildford Road.

Alternative Route: Lower Guildford Road (Service Road) and Lower Guildford Road. This Order is required to facilitate utility works for, or on behalf of UKPN. These works are anticipated to be carried out over 5 days between the hours of 8am and 6pm, during the 12-month period of operation of this Temporary Order that commences on 26 February 2024.

Advanced warning signs will be displayed and the temporary closure, which is anticipated to be in operation 24 hours per day, will only operate when the relevant traffic signs are displayed. Access to premises within the affected length of road, including access by emergency service vehicles to these properties will be maintained at all times, as will access for pedestrians and cyclists.
